Speciation does not always happen at the same speed. Scientists describe two patterns of how evolutionary change happens during speciation: gradualism and punctuated equilibrium.
Imagine a bird species living on an island with varied food sources.
As natural selection favors birds with beak shapes better suited to available food sources, beak shapes change slightly over time.
After many thousands, or even millions, of years, these tiny changes add up, and a new species forms.
This process describes gradualism, in which populations change in small steps over many generations.
Now consider a sudden event, such as a storm, that carries a small group of these birds to a new island.
The available food is limited and different from before, which makes survival more difficult.
Birds with beaks that are better suited to the new food survive and reproduce more, so the population’s beak shape changes.
A new species forms over a relatively short period and then remains stable for a long time, sometimes for thousands or even millions of years, until another rapid change is triggered.
This pattern describes punctuated equilibrium, with brief bursts of speciation followed by long periods of stability.
